I have two sheets with data. The first sheet is from one application with
dollars and a key number (like CUSIP). The second file is the same but from another system. I want to recon these but do it through a macro. I can create a macro to sort each by cusip and amount , but I want to read one record and compair cusip + amount and if the same then to to the next record. If different , then write it to a separate sheet. Do I have to use VB for this and if yes, can it be without buying VB. Someone said newer releases of Excel does not have VB to work with? |
